Some tips for your next blurb book:
1.  Get the 12x12 book for the big beautiful 1 page photos.
2. Let them leave the blurb logo on the very last page. It saves $ and is no biggie.
3. I am partial to the image wrap cover and the Premium Paper, lustre finish.  
4. Go with the gray end sheet to save money. 
5. These books are high quality and more expensive than many alternatives. Always google for a coupon.
